Driving directions from Karachi, Pakistan to Shangliyuan, China distance


Karachi, Pakistan
Shangliyuan, China
Karachi to Shangliyuan road map

Karachi to Shangliyuan flight distance miles / km

2,520.6 mi / 4,056.6 km
Also see in Pakistan
Of interest in China